    Satellite Manufacturing Launch Market Summary

    As per MRFR analysis, the Satellite Manufacturing And Launch Market was estimated at 29.76 USD Billion in 2024. The satellite industry is projected to grow from 33.93 USD Billion in 2025 to 125.88 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 14.01 during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

    Regional Insights

    By region, the study offers market insights into Asia-Pacific, Europe, North America, and Rest of the World. North America Satellite Manufacturing And Launch market accounted for USD 10.48 billion in 2022 and is expected to exhibit a significant CAGR growth during the study period. It is attributed to the high investments by the U.S. government and space agencies in satellite manufacturing and the development of reusable launch systems. In September 2019, NASA awarded a contract of USD 4,600 million to Lockheed Martin Corporation to provide six reusable Orion crew capsules integrated with lightweight 3D printed modules.

    Furthermore, several key players involved in market manufacturers engaged in the market, such as Lockheed Martin Corporation and Boeing, are further supporting the growth of the market in North America. Further, the United States Satellite Manufacturing And Launch market held the largest market share in the North American region.     Europe Satellite Manufacturing And Launch market account for the second-largest market share due to several key players involved in the market, such as Airbus S.A.S., Arianespace, ISISPACE GROUP, JSC Academician M.F. Reshetnev, and others drive the development of the market across Europe. Moreover, the UK Satellite Manufacturing And Launch market held the largest market sharenwhereas Germany Satellite Manufacturing And Launch market is the fast growing in the region. The Asia-Pacific Satellite Manufacturing And Launch Market are anticipated to surge at the fastest CAGR from 2023 to 2030.

    It is due to increasing satellite launch infrastructure and satellite launch programs from countries such as China, India, and Australia. 

    For instance,In November 2020

    The Indian Space Research Organization (ISRO) successfully launched ten earth observation satellites and payloads. Moreover, China Satellite Manufacturing And Launch market held the largest market share, and the India Satellite Manufacturing And Launch market was the fastest growing market in the Asia-Pacific region

Lockheed Martin Corporation offers a wide range of small satellites, mid-satellites, and GEO satellites. It has built nearly 800 spacecraft. The company provides experience in developing and designing reusable space solutions.

    For advanced space solution system development, the company has adopted technological collaboration, joint ventures, and investment in R&D activities. For instance, in February 2021, Lockheed Martin signed a contract with ABL Space Systems to provide rocket and related launch services for the UK pathfinder launch project, the first UK vertical satellite launch. The satellite launch is expected to be completed by 2022. Also, Arianespace SA is a French-based satellite launch service provider. It undertakes the operation and marketing of the Ariane program.

    For instance, in November 2020, Arianespace signed an agreement with one of the operators for an Ariane 5 launch of a communications satellite into geostationary orbit. The satellite is scheduled for launch in 2022.

    Industry Developments

    • Q2 2025: bluShift Aerospace to commence small satellite launches from rural Northeast U.S. in 2025 bluShift Aerospace, a Maine-based startup, announced it will begin launching small satellites from Maine in 2025, aiming to establish the state as a hub for nanosatellite launches and provide a cost-effective alternative to larger providers.
    • Q2 2025: Rocket Lab to debut Neutron rocket, a fully reusable medium-lift vehicle, in mid-2025 Rocket Lab is set to launch its Neutron rocket, a fully reusable medium-lift vehicle capable of delivering up to 15 tons to low Earth orbit, positioning the company as a major competitor in the small-to-medium satellite launch market.
    • Q4 2024: SpaceX Falcon 9 achieves over 300 successful booster landings by November 2024 SpaceX reached a milestone with its Falcon 9 rocket, surpassing 300 successful booster landings, underscoring the company's leadership in reusable launch vehicle technology.
